A significant financial incentive for prospective electric vehicle (EV) owners in the UK has officially launched today, August 28th, offering substantial reductions on the purchase of new models. This government initiative aims to accelerate the adoption of electric cars by making them more accessible and affordable for a wider range of motorists, directly contributing to the nation’s sustainable transport agenda.

Under the new scheme, eligible car buyers can benefit from grants ranging from £1,500 to a more substantial £3,750. Initially, two specific vehicle models, the Ford Puma Gen-E and the Ford E-Tourneo Courier, qualify for the higher £3,750 reduction, immediately putting money back into the pockets of consumers opting for these greener alternatives. While other announced models qualify for the £1,500 grant, the government anticipates a swift expansion of the eligible vehicle list in the near future.

This pioneering grant program is a cornerstone of the government’s expansive £650 million strategy, meticulously designed to ease the financial burden of EV ownership. Beyond individual savings, the initiative is poised to invigorate the UK’s vital automotive industry. As a key sector identified in the modern Industrial Strategy, the automotive industry currently supports 133,000 jobs directly and an additional 320,000 jobs within the broader economy, underscoring the scheme’s potential for wide-ranging economic benefits.

The eligibility criteria for the grants are straightforward: discounts are automatically applied at the point of sale, simplifying the purchasing process for consumers. To qualify for the incentives, electric vehicles must adhere to specific sustainability standards and have a maximum purchase price not exceeding £37,000. A total of 28 electric vehicles have been identified as eligible for either the £3,750 or £1,500 grant, offering a diverse selection for UK motorists.

The government’s commitment extends beyond purchase grants, with pledges of over £4.5 billion dedicated to assisting both businesses and individual buyers in their shift to electric vehicles. The Electric Car Grant scheme is a crucial component in maintaining the UK’s prominent position as a global leader in EV uptake, showcasing a proactive approach to environmental responsibility and technological advancement.

Further supporting the EV ecosystem, a substantial £63 million charging program was unveiled in July. This funding package is specifically allocated to reducing the costs associated with charging infrastructure, particularly focusing on making home charging more attainable. This initiative aims to enable EV drivers, even those without off-street parking, to power their vehicles for as little as 2p per mile, addressing a key barrier to widespread electric vehicle adoption.
